30-12-206. Investigations

Universal Citation: MT Code § 30-12-206 (2022)

30-12-206. Investigations. The department shall investigate complaints made to it concerning violations of parts 1 through 5. It shall, upon its own initiative, conduct those investigations it considers appropriate and advisable to develop information on prevailing procedures in commercial quantity determination and on possible violations of parts 1 through 5 and to promote the general objective of accuracy in the determination and representation of quantity in commercial transactions.

History: En. Sec. 11, Ch. 99, L. 1969; amd. Sec. 152, Ch. 431, L. 1975; R.C.M. 1947, 90-163.
